The Ultimate Buying Guide: A Purrfect Choice for Your Feline Friend
Interactive cat toys are a fantastic way to keep your kitty entertained, active, and mentally stimulated. They mimic prey, engage your cat’s natural hunting instincts, and can even help prevent boredom and destructive behaviors. Choosing the right interactive toy can be a game-changer for both you and your cat.
Key Features to Look For
1. Movement and unpredictability
Cats love toys that move in surprising ways. Look for toys that flutter, dart, wiggle, or change direction unexpectedly. This unpredictability keeps them engaged and excited.
2. Sound and Texture
Some cats are attracted to crinkly sounds or soft, enticing textures. Toys with bells, feathers, or different fabric types can add an extra layer of appeal.
3. Durability and Safety
Your cat will likely chew, bat, and pounce on its toys. Ensure the toy is made from sturdy materials that won’t easily break or splinter. Small, detachable parts are a choking hazard and should be avoided.
4. Power Source (if applicable)
Many electronic interactive toys use batteries. Consider how easy they are to replace and the battery life. Some toys are rechargeable, which can be a more convenient option.
5. Ease of Use for Humans
Some toys require you to actively play with your cat, while others operate on their own. Think about how much time you have to dedicate to playtime. Self-playing toys are great for when you’re busy.
Important Materials
The materials used in interactive cat toys play a big role in their safety and appeal. Here are some common and good ones:
- Felt and Fabric: Soft fabrics like felt, fleece, and plush are safe for chewing and batting. They often feel good in a cat’s mouth.
- Feathers: Natural or synthetic feathers mimic bird prey and are highly attractive to cats.
- Cardboard and Sisal Rope: These natural materials are great for scratching and batting. They offer a satisfying texture for cats.
- Durable Plastics: For some electronic toys, sturdy, non-toxic plastics are used. Look for BPA-free options.
- Catnip: Many toys are infused with catnip, a natural herb that excites and relaxes many cats.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Improving Quality:
- Sturdy Construction: Toys that hold up well to rough play are a sign of good quality.
- Non-Toxic Materials: Safety is paramount. Toys made with safe, pet-friendly materials are always superior.
- Engaging Design: Toys that truly capture a cat’s attention and encourage play are high quality.
- Replaceable Parts: For toys with feathers or strings, the ability to replace worn-out parts can extend the toy’s life.
Reducing Quality:
- Flimsy Construction: Toys that fall apart easily are not only a waste of money but can also be dangerous.
- Small, Detachable Parts: These pose a choking risk and significantly reduce a toy’s quality and safety.
- Toxic Dyes or Glues: Some cheaper toys might use harmful chemicals.
- Predictable Movement: If a toy always moves the same way, your cat will quickly lose interest.
User Experience and Use Cases
Interactive cat toys offer a variety of benefits for different situations.
For Boredom and Loneliness:
If your cat spends a lot of time alone, self-playing toys can provide much-needed stimulation. These toys keep them occupied and can prevent destructive behaviors that stem from boredom.
For Exercise and Weight Management:
Toys that encourage chasing and pouncing are excellent for getting your cat moving. This is especially important for indoor cats who may not get enough natural exercise. Regular play helps maintain a healthy weight and overall fitness.
For Mental Stimulation and Training:
Some puzzle toys dispense treats and require your cat to figure out how to get them. This mental challenge keeps their minds sharp and can be a fun way to bond and train your cat.
For Bonding with Your Cat:
Toys that you operate, like laser pointers or wand toys, are perfect for interactive playtime. This shared activity strengthens the bond between you and your feline companion.
When choosing an interactive cat toy, consider your cat’s personality, age, and energy level. A playful kitten might enjoy a fast-moving toy, while a senior cat might prefer something more gentle and mentally stimulating.
Frequently Asked Questions About Interactive Cat Toys
Q: What are the main benefits of interactive cat toys?
A: Interactive cat toys help keep cats active, entertained, and mentally stimulated. They also prevent boredom and can reduce destructive behaviors.
Q: Are all interactive cat toys safe for cats?
A: No, not all toys are safe. You should always check for small, detachable parts that could be a choking hazard and ensure the materials are non-toxic.
Q: How often should I let my cat play with interactive toys?
A: Aim for several short play sessions throughout the day, especially with toys that require your interaction. For self-playing toys, supervise initial use.
Q: My cat seems scared of new toys. What should I do?
A: Introduce new toys slowly. Let your cat sniff them and explore them at their own pace. You can also try associating the toy with treats or praise.
Q: What is the best type of interactive toy for a lazy cat?
A: For a less active cat, consider puzzle toys that dispense treats or toys with gentle, slow movements that still pique their curiosity.
Q: My cat destroys toys very quickly. What should I look for?
A: You’ll need durable toys made from strong materials like reinforced fabric, tough plastics, or natural fibers like sisal rope.
Q: Are electronic interactive toys worth the money?
A: They can be, especially for busy owners or cats who need extra stimulation. Look for ones with good reviews and a variety of features.
Q: Can interactive toys help my cat with weight issues?
A: Yes, toys that encourage chasing and pouncing are great for burning calories and helping your cat maintain a healthy weight.
Q: How do I clean interactive cat toys?
A: Cleaning instructions vary by toy. Some fabric toys can be machine washed, while others might need to be wiped down with a damp cloth.
Q: My cat is an indoor-only cat. Are interactive toys especially important for them?
A: Yes, interactive toys are very important for indoor cats. They provide the exercise and mental stimulation they would normally get from hunting outdoors.
